International Education Week Nov. 14-19

International Education Week will be held Nov. 14-19 and will feature events for the UC and Greater Cincinnati community.

The University of Cincinnati highlights International Education Week with keynote speaker Bol Aweng, one of the 35,000 so-called Lost Boys who fled southern Sudan during the second Sudanese Civil War. Aweng will detail his life then and now when he speaks at UC from 7-8:30 p.m., Tuesday, Nov. 15, in Room 400 A,B,C of Tangeman University Center (TUC).
